Why Summer Punishes Your Legs More Than You Think
Heat changes how your body feels. When temperatures climb, your blood vessels can relax and open up. This can make fluid pool in your lower legs and feet, which may lead to swelling, puffiness, and that heavy feeling when you finally sit down at night.
Summer habits can make this even stronger. Think about how many things load more work onto your legs:
- Extra walking on vacations and sightseeing
- Long days standing at outdoor concerts and festivals
- Hours on your feet at family gatherings, cookouts, or kids’ games
- Long road trips or flights where you barely move at all
All of that adds up. Your calves and ankles carry you along hot sidewalks, sandy beaches, and uneven trails. Then, when you do sit, it is often for long stretches in a car seat or plane seat, where circulation can slow down.
On top of that, typical summer choices can affect how your legs feel:
- Dehydration from heat and not drinking enough water
- Salty snacks and quick meals that may make you feel puffy
- Inconsistent movement, like going from all-day sitting to sudden long walks
The result can be soreness, tight calves, foot cramps, and bedtime discomfort that keeps you from deep rest.

Step-by-step Evening Ritual for Sore, Tired Summer Legs
A calm, 10 to 15-minute nighttime ritual can reset your legs before sleep. Think of it as a daily reset button for everything your lower body did for you that day.
Here is a simple routine you can try:
1. Cool down
Find a spot to lie back and gently raise your legs on a pillow or folded blanket. Use a cool, not icy, cloth over your calves and ankles, or take a quick cool shower from knees to feet. This can help ease that hot, puffy feeling that is common after a long day in the sun.

3. Stretch and decompress
Finish with 3 to 5 minutes of gentle movement:
- Simple calf stretches using a wall or the edge of a step
- Soft hamstring stretches while sitting or lying down
- Slow ankle rolls in both directions
- Deep belly breaths to tell your system it is time to wind down

Travel and Activity Tips to Prevent Summer Leg Burnout
Good daily choices can reduce how hard your legs have to work in the first place. Small habits add up, especially during hot months when you are on the move around town or away on trips.
Try adding some of these into your days:
Movement breaks
- Take short walks during road trip stops
- Stand and stretch your calves and hips during long flights
- Do a few calf raises while brushing your teeth or waiting for coffee
Hydration and recovery
- Drink water steadily through the day, not all at once at night
- Balance salty snacks with foods that have more fluid or minerals, like fruits and simple whole foods

Smart footwear and surfaces
- Pick supportive shoes for sightseeing instead of flat, thin sandals
- Use cushioned sandals or shoes when you know you will be standing on hard ground
- When you can, mix it up between hard sidewalks and softer paths or grass
These simple shifts help keep your legs from reaching that point of total burnout by mid-summer.
